About Group Audit

As a global function of approximately 850 team members, Group Audit (GA) is the bank's 'Third Line of Defence' acting as an independent and forward-looking challenger and adviser to Senior Management. We are also strongly relied upon by local regulators. We closely partner and collaborate with all Group business and infrastructure areas. This includes the Investment Bank, Corporate Bank and International Private Bank businesses, and Technology, Anti-Financial Crime, Compliance, Risk, Finance and Operations infrastructure functions. Your Key Responsibilities:

  • This position will support the Findings Validations portfolio by facilitating efficient and effective operations, thereby contributing to the maintenance of a proactive and forward-looking Group Audit function.

  • Identify automation opportunities, develop solutions to streamline validations reporting and data collection processes, and enhance efficiency.

  • Serve as the primary contact with central GA functions for tasks such as annual planning, FTE reporting, coordination and tracking of requests, and methodology changes.

  • Serve as the point of contact for Validation Centre colleagues and managers across all three locations – Manila, Mumbai, and Madrid – to support the Head of the Validation Centre

  • Evaluate data analytics requests and collaborate with auditors, data owners, and developers to deliver functional solutions and analytics in an agile and iterative manner.

  • Partner with Regional Business Managers to provide all levels of BM support to the Head of Audit and Chief Auditors.

  • Coordinate global Townhalls for the Validations portfolio.

Deutsche Bank AG is a German multinational investment bank and financial services company headquartered in Frankfurt, Germany, and dual-listed on the Frankfurt Stock Exchange and the New York Stock Exchange.
